Capital Levies for Schools

2022 Capital Levy for Technology and Facilities

On Feb. 8, 2022, voters approved a Capital Projects Levy for technology and facilities. 

Funds collected through the levy are being used to modernize technology systems throughout the school district, such as student and staff​ computers and classroom presentation equipment (ActivPanels, document cameras).

Funds are also being used for essential facility needs to ensure ongoing operations and safe learning environments, such as upgrading and replacing security cameras and essential building system components for HVAC, electrical, plumbing, fire panels, etc.

When does the 2022 Capital Levy expire?

The measure on the February 2022 ballot was approved by voters to renew funding for a replacement capital projects levy that runs for six years beginning in 2023 and continues through 2028.
